I've done some searching and found that this solar farm is a cooperative 
effort between the Norman Public Schools (I live in Norman, OK) and the 
Oklahoma Electric Cooperative (OEC); it's being built by a third-party 
contractor whose name I haven't yet found. It'll cover 15 ac  and will 
also encompass a Renewable Science Education Center. The farm will be on 
land owned by Norman Public Schools which will be leased by the OEC. The 
latest from OEC says it will consist of 7208 solar panels. I also 
learned that there's a 250 kW pilot project run by OEC about 8 mi away; 
I'll go by it and listen for any RFI. So far, this has been what I can 
find about it.

i would say it depends which manufacturer makes the controllers/inverters......
 
 
Overall system engineering also matters -- how the cables are run, are they in 
steel conduit, if not in conduit are they twisted pair, are the current loops 
tightly closed, etc.  Higher voltage, lower current also helps reduce noise and 
boost efficiency.
